The Deep Dive

To add these mixed numbers, first convert them to improper fractions. For \(2 \frac{1}{6}\), it becomes \(\frac{12 + 1}{6} = \frac{13}{6}\). For \(3 \frac{1}{3}\), it becomes \(\frac{9 + 1}{3} = \frac{10}{3}\). Now, find a common denominator (which is 6) to add them: \(\frac{10}{3} = \frac{20}{6}\). Now, add: \(\frac{13}{6} + \frac{20}{6} = \frac{33}{6}\). Convert back to a mixed number: \(\frac{33}{6} = 5 \frac{3}{6} = 5 \frac{1}{2}\). So, \(2 \frac{1}{6} + 3 \frac{1}{3} = 5 \frac{1}{2}\).
